FTIN - Aula 01

Propaganda
FTIN
Formação Técnica em Informática
Módulo de Administração de Servidores de
Rede – AULA 01
Prof. Gabriel Silva
COMPETÊNCIAS A SEREM DESENVOLVIDAS
Administração de Servidores de Rede
Aprenderemos: funcionamento da rede de
computadores, gerenciar servidores Microsoft e
Linux, configurar serviços, aprimorar segurança, gerir
usuários, detectar problemas, conhecer utilitários e
ferramentas utilizadas para administração dos
servidores.
FTIN – FORMAÇÃO TÉCNICA EM INFORMÁTICA
Temas da Aula de Hoje:
• Significado de Redes de Computadores.
• Conceitos Básicos de Rede.
• Protocolos de Comunicação.
• Endereçamento.
• Modelo OSI.
• Modelo TCP/IP.
Temas da Aula de Hoje:
• Serviços e Portas.
• Software Recomendados.
• Atividades.
Significado de Redes de
Computadores
• DEFINIÇÃO:
- Módulos Processadores interligados através
de enlaces de comunicação.
- Possui como finalidade compartilhar
recursos e trocar informações.
Conceitos Básicos de Rede
• Client / Server ( Cliente / Servidor) :
- Os computadores que provem serviços são
denominados Servidores, enquanto aos que
acessam os serviços são chamados de clientes.
Conceitos Básicos de Rede
• Existem vários tipos de servidores. Os mais
conhecidos são: Servidor de Fax, de arquivos, web,
e-mail, imagens, FTP.
• Cada um destes servidores executa uma função,
por exemplo: para você visualizar uma página no
Baixaki, você está utilizando o Servidor web, o
qual é responsável pelo armazenamento das
páginas de um site.
Conceitos Básicos de Rede
• Para que você consiga abrir páginas web, utiliza
um navegador.
• Portanto, navegador é o cliente e o site é o
servidor, pois o primeiro acessa informações
disponibilizadas pelo segundo.
• Desta forma, as redes que utilizam servidores são
chamadas do tipo Cliente-Servidor
Protocolos de Comunicação
• Conjunto de regras sobre o modo como se dará a
comunicação entre as partes envolvidas.
• Em outras palavras, Protocolo é a "língua" dos
computadores; ou seja, uma espécie de idioma
que segue normas e padrões determinados.
Protocolos de Comunicação
• ISO - A Organização Internacional para
Padronização (International Organization for
Standardization).
• Popularmente conhecida como ISO é uma
entidade que congrega os grêmios de
padronização/normalização de 170 países.
Protocolos de Comunicação
• Alguns protocolos de rede:
-
TCP;
UDP;
ICMP;
SIP;
GRE.
Protocolos de Comunicação
TCP - (Transmission Control Protocol)
• Garante a entrega de datagramas IP.
• Executar a segmentação e o reagrupamento de
grandes blocos de dados enviados pelos
programas, garantir o sequenciamento adequado e
a entrega ordenada de dados segmentados.
Protocolos de Comunicação
• O funcionamento do TCP é baseado em conexões. Assim,
para um computador cliente iniciar uma "conversa" com
um servidor, é necessário enviar um sinal denominado
SYN.
• Logo, o servidor responde enviando um sinal SYN
combinado com um sinal de nome ACK para confirmar a
conexão. O cliente responde com outro sinal ACK, fazendo
com que a conexão esteja estabelecida e pronta para a
troca de dados.
• Por ser feita em três transmissões, esse processo é
conhecimento handshake.
Protocolos de Comunicação
Protocolos de Comunicação
• Visualização do handshake
[root@ns1 ~]# tcpdump -n -i eth0 port 21
tcpdump: verbose output suppressed, use -v or -vv for full protocol decode
listening on eth0, link-type EN10MB (Ethernet), capture size 96 bytes
02:06:27.905586 IP 179.197.83.102.50848 > 189.11.210.19.ftp: S
2212670378:2212670378(0) win 8192 <mss 1440,nop,wscale
8,nop,nop,sackOK>
02:06:27.905643 IP 189.11.210.19.ftp > 179.197.83.102.50848: S
1319868354:1319868354(0) ack 2212670379 win 5840 <mss
1460,nop,nop,sackOK,nop,wscale 7>
02:06:27.959858 IP 179.197.83.102.50848 > 189.11.210.19.ftp: . ack 1 win
258
Protocolos de Comunicação
• UDP - (User Datagram Protocol)
• Tido como um protocolo "irmão" do TCP, mas é mais
simples e também menos confiável. Isso acontece
porque o funcionamento do TCP é, como já dito,
baseado em conexões, o que não ocorre com o UDP.
• Como consequência, não há procedimentos de
verificação no envio e recebimento de dados (todavia,
pode haver checagem de integridade) e se algum pacote
não for recebido, o computador de destino não faz uma
nova solicitação, como acontece com o TCP.
• Tudo isso faz do UDP um pouco mais rápido, porém
inutilizável em certas aplicações.
Protocolos de Comunicação
• Por essas características, pode parecer que o UDP é
inútil, mas não é. Há aplicações em que é preferível
entregar os dados o mais rapidamente possível,
mesmo que algumas informações se percam no
caminho.
• É o caso, por exemplo, das transmissões de vídeo pela
internet (streaming), onde a perda de um pacote de
dados não interromperá a transmissão.
• Por outro lado, se os pacotes não chegarem ou
demorarem a chegar, haverá congelamentos na
imagem, causando irritação no usuário.
Endereçamento
• Existem dois tipos de endereço ip:
- Endereço público;
- Endereço privado (particular).
• Um endereço IP é um valor numérico exclusivo
usado para identificar um computador em uma
rede.
Endereçamento
• Endereços IP públicos: são atribuídos pela IANA
(Internet Assigned Numbers Authority, autoridade
de números atribuídos da Internet).
• Os endereços são garantidos como exclusivos
globalmente e acessíveis na Internet. Isso impede
que vários computadores tenham o mesmo
endereço IP.
Endereçamento
• Endereços IP particulares: não podem ser usados
na Internet.
• A IANA alocou três blocos de endereços IP que
não podem ser usados na Internet global.
Endereçamento
Esses três blocos de endereços são IP particulares
(privados):
- 192.168.0.0/16: Este bloco permite endereços IP
válidos no intervalo de 192.168.0.1 a
192.168.255.254.
- 172.16.0.0/12: Este bloco permite endereços IP
válidos
no
intervalo
de
172.16.0.1
a
172.31.255.254.
- 10.0.0.0/8: Este bloco permite endereços IP válidos
no intervalo de 10.0.0.1 a 10.255.255.254.
Endereçamento
• Existem duas versões do protocolo IP:
- IPV4, é a versão em uso. Utilizamos na grande
maioria das situações;
- IPV6, é a versão atualizada. Prevê um número
brutalmente maior de endereços e deve se
popularizar a partir de 2012 ou 2014, quando os
endereços IPV4 começarem a se esgotar.
Endereçamento
• Um endereço IPv4 é formado por 32 bits.
- Cálculo: 2^32 = 4.294.967.296 endereços
- Aproximadamente 4 bilhões de endereços!
• Um endereço IPv6 é formado por 128 bits.
- Cálculo: 2^128 = 340.282.366.920.938.463.......
endereços
- 79 trilhões de trilhões de vezes mais que no IPv4!
Modelo OSI
• O Modelo OSI (criado em 1970 e formalizado em
1983) é um modelo de referência da ISO que tinha
com principal objetivo ser um modelo
standard(padrão), para protocolos de comunicação
entre os mais diversos sistemas, e assim garantir a
comunicação end-to-end.
Modelo OSI
Modelo TCP/IP
• De uma forma simples, o TCP/IP é o principal
modelo de protocolo de envio e recebimento de
dados de internet.
• TCP significa Transmission Control Protocol
(Protocolo de Controle de Transmissão) e o IP,
Internet Protocol (Protocolo de Internet).
Modelo TCP/IP
Serviços e Portas
• Numerosos programas TCP/IP podem ser
executados simultaneamente na Internet (por
exemplo,
abrir
vários
navegadores
simultaneamente ou navegar em páginas HTML
descarregando ao mesmo tempo um arquivo por
FTP).
• Cada um destes programas trabalha com
um protocolo, contudo o computador deve poder
distinguir as diferentes fontes de dados.
Serviços e Portas
• Cada Protocolo de transporte (TCP ou UDP)
permite a existência de 65535 portas.
• Portanto as aplicações (serviços) podem variar de
0 a 65535.
Serviço e Portas
• As portas de 0 a 1023 são chamadas portas
baixas, elas são portas padrões, relacionadas a
algum serviço.
• Ex:
Serviço
HTTP
FTP
Porta
80
21
Serviço e Portas
• As portas 1024 a 65535 são chamadas de portas
altas, e utilizadas para comunicação com outros
serviços
Serviços e Portas
• No Windows ou Linux, podemos verificar portas
abertas com o comando: netstat.
Softwares Recomendados
• Para um melhor acompanhamento deste módulo,
recomendo:
-
VirtualBox, para criação de máquinas virtuais e prática;
Ubuntu 12.04LTS Server, como servidor linux;
Ubuntu 12.04LTS Desktop, como cliente;
Windows Server 2003 ou 2008 Standard, como servidor
Microsoft;
- Windows XP Professional ou Windows 7 Professional.
FTIN – FORMAÇÃO TÉCNICA EM INFORMÁTICA
ATIVIDADE
Atividade
1º Pesquise 5 serviços com seus respectivos
protocolos, que não foram falados na aula, e
nem estão nos slides, e descreva sua finalidade
e sua porta padrão.
Ex: Serviço HTTP – Protocolo TCP, Serviço de paginas da web, porta padrão
80.
2º Em um computador windows execute o
comando: netstat e netstat /n e descreva a
diferença entre os dois comandos.
DICAS PARA SUA ATIVIDADE
SER SFO!!!
Nossa atividade deve ter os seguintes tópicos:
Capa:
+ Nome do Aluno
+ Nome do Tutor + Módulo + Disciplina + Nº da Atividade.
Sumário: Tópicos da atividade e sua localização na atividade (nº da página).
Introdução: Suas considerações sobre a atividade.
Desenvolvimento: Apresentação de todos os tópicos da atividade, atendendo ao solicitado
pelo Professor, sempre mostrando sua própria produção.
Lembrando que cada tópico corresponde a um subtítulo, que deve estar destacado no texto.
O texto deve ter no mínimo 10 linhas e no máximo 25 linhas, fonte Arial, tamanho 12
Conclusão: Suas considerações finais. Devem ser exclusivamente suas!
Bibliografia/Fonte de Pesquisa: Links e livros consultados (Revistas técnicas também são
uma ótima opção de pesquisa!)
Utilize o Guia “Minha Atividade é SFO!”
Disponível no AVA
36
ATIVIDADE
DATA E HORÁRIO DA ENTREGA DA
ATIVIDADE ESTÃO NO FORUM.
EVITE DEIXAR A POSTAGEM DE SUA
ATIVIDADE PARA O ÚLTIMO DIA.
FAZENDO ISSO, IMPREVISTOS NÃO VÃO
LHE PREJUDICAR.
* LEMBRANDO QUE SUA
ORGANIZAÇÃO TAMBÉM ESTA SENDO
AVALIADA
FTIN – FORMAÇÃO TÉCNICA EM INFORMÁTICA
Dúvidas
Acesse o Fórum!!
Chat!!
FTIN – FORMAÇÃO TÉCNICA EM INFORMÁTICA
Download